This project develops a microfluidic chip to measure extensional flow in complex biological fluids, such as synovial fluid and mucus. The goal is to understand how these fluids behave under stress, which is crucial for diagnosing and treating related diseases.
Extensional flows occur widely in important biological functions of complex fluids, e.g. blood circulation, respiratory and gastrointestinal mucin flows and the synovial fluid in the joints.
Extensional flows can significantly stretch the long-chain molecules present in such fluids, resulting in dramatic increases in flow resistance that are not quantified by standard rheological tests, yet are vital for full characterization of fluid samples.
